X-Git-Url: https://git.mxchange.org/?a=blobdiff_plain;f=view%2Ftheme%2Ffrost%2Ftheme.php;h=1692560341035b6d7e32fc216051185503ff6b56;hb=cd392db0785fcc8dfc95af99bee934a231ba9016;hp=5d5162cd32afd62514b2470cb51d86a5f65121b7;hpb=ff459441cfd86375a7b0ed5f2d6854fbd0ae3a00;p=friendica.git diff --git a/view/theme/frost/theme.php b/view/theme/frost/theme.php index 5d5162cd32..1692560341 100644 --- a/view/theme/frost/theme.php +++ b/view/theme/frost/theme.php @@ -10,8 +10,9 @@ */ use Friendica\App; +use Friendica\Core\Addon; use Friendica\Core\System; -use Friendica\Object\Photo; +use Friendica\Object\Image; function frost_init(App $a) { $a->videowidth = 400; @@ -35,27 +36,27 @@ function frost_content_loaded(App $a) { } function frost_install() { - register_hook('prepare_body_final', 'view/theme/frost/theme.php', 'frost_item_photo_links'); + Addon::registerHook('prepare_body_final', 'view/theme/frost/theme.php', 'frost_item_photo_links'); logger("installed theme frost"); } function frost_uninstall() { - unregister_hook('bbcode', 'view/theme/frost/theme.php', 'frost_bbcode'); + Addon::unregisterHook('bbcode', 'view/theme/frost/theme.php', 'frost_bbcode'); logger("uninstalled theme frost"); } function frost_item_photo_links(App $a, &$body_info) { - $phototypes = Photo::supportedTypes(); + $phototypes = Image::supportedTypes(); $occurence = 1; $p = bb_find_open_close($body_info['html'], ""); while($p !== false && ($occurence++ < 500)) { $link = substr($body_info['html'], $p['start'], $p['end'] - $p['start']); - $matches = array(); + $matches = []; preg_match("/\/photos\/[\w]+\/image\/([\w]+)/", $link, $matches); if($matches) {